Output 80c85fc2836c138fc762120930e79246b0d6e9d0e4a9f7790cbd867f396e9e0a:1

value
923968
script pubkey
OP_0 OP_PUSHBYTES_20 fe8e28bf7f06635ae439e0b5e776353376fc8c60
address
ltc1ql68z30mlqe344epeuz67wa34xdm0errq48gyy9
transaction
80c85fc2836c138fc762120930e79246b0d6e9d0e4a9f7790cbd867f396e9e0a
spent
true